CPC Main Group
F16F 7/00 Vibration-dampers; Shock-absorbers (using fluid F16F5/00, F16F9/00; specific for rotary systems F16F15/10 )

- F16F 7/01 using friction between loose particles, e.g. sand
- F16F 7/02 with relatively-rotatable friction surfaces that are pressed together (F16F7/01 takes precedence; one of the members being a spring F16F13/02 )
- F16F 7/08 with friction surfaces rectilinearly movable along each other (F16F7/01 takes precedence )
- F16F 7/10 using inertia effect (F16F13/108, F16F13/22, F16F15/10, F16F15/22 take precedence; stabilising vehicle bodies by means of movable masses B62D37/04; protection of buildings against vibrations or shocks by mass dampers E04H9/0215; arrangements or devices for damping mechanical oscillations of power lines H02G7/14)
- F16F 7/12 using plastic deformation of members
- F16F 7/14 of cable support type, i.e. frictionally-engaged loop-forming cables
